## Changelog — Tilebird Prefetcher v3.2

Heads up, support folks: we changed the default prefetch radius and cache TTL because rural users kept burning mobile data on tiles they never viewed. Expect fewer "slow map" tickets but maybe a few "blurry zoom" ones for a week. Old installs pick up the new defaults on restart. The new defaults are as follows.

deployment values, yadug-bawif:
[framir]
team = pelox
access_code = ac_a38ab2
owner = tamion.julael
host = framir.tolvaqlabs.test
port = 11211
peer = tammir.zemvargrid.local
salt = 2215ef03
pin = 1541

The prior flow allowed token reuse within a short race window and lacked rate limiting on the request endpoint, which enabled the enumeration attempt we observed. The new flow issues single-use tokens bound to a session nonce, invalidates siblings on redemption, and throttles requests per account and per source. Please verify that the chosen expiry, throttle, and lockout values align with the Marrowgate security baseline before sign-off. The tuning constants under review are as follows.

tuning constants:
QUOTAS = {
    "druwyn": 5,
    "holix": 5,
    "zorath": 5,
    "holwyn": 10,
}

Handover Note — Director Transition, Brellick Manufacturing

To: Branch Managers

As I pass operations to Director Soline Varsh, the Drayfield factory capacity decision remains open. Option A expands the second shift; Option B adds a third press line. Costings are with finance, and union consultation starts next month. Branch managers should keep staffing projections current. Soline will need the context noted confidentially below before deciding.

confidential, kagup-bafog: Fraaxax Group is in early talks to buy Soroxox Group for about $343.8 million. The Olidor launch date is June 14, and nothing goes to the press before then. Legal wants the Aldmirek Logistics term sheet signed before July 23.

## Deploying the Gatewick Proctor Queue

Deploys are pretty painless: push to main, wait for the pipeline, then watch the queue drain dashboard for five minutes. If candidates pile up mid-exam, roll back first and ask questions later — the queue replays safely. Everything the workers care about lives in one config block, shown here for reference.

settings of bafof-yagef:
JOROX_PIN=8740
JOROX_TENANT=pelox
JOROX_METRICS_HOST=metrics.jorox.qorvelworks.internal
JOROX_SEAL=seal_c78f63c1
JOROX_STANDBY_TEAM=norax